Chippewa County, Michigan: 87.9% of Pre-Foreclosures Near Auction with 33 Active Filings

Chippewa County, Michigan, currently tracks 33 active pre-foreclosures over the past 12 months, signaling a pipeline where nearly 88% of properties are in the final stages before auction. This concentration in late-stage filings suggests a market poised for potential distressed inventory, offering specific opportunities for real estate investors and agents monitoring the region.

County Overview

According to BatchData's Active Pre-Foreclosures Report for July 2026, Chippewa County recorded 33 active pre-foreclosures, directly impacting 33 individual parcels. This total places Chippewa County #44 among Michigan's 82 counties, representing a 0.3% share of the state's total active pre-foreclosures. While the overall volume is modest compared to larger metropolitan areas, the distribution across the pre-foreclosure pipeline stages reveals a distinct characteristic of the local market.

A deep dive into the pre-foreclosure stages shows a significant concentration at the Notice of Sale stage, which accounts for 29 properties, or 87.9% of the county's active pipeline. This stage is the latest in the pre-foreclosure process, indicating that these properties are nearing a potential foreclosure auction. Following this, the Notice of Default stage, which marks the initial formal notification of missed mortgage payments, comprises 3 properties, or 9.1%. The Notice of Lis Pendens, an intermediate stage, includes just 1 property, representing 3.0% of the total. The heavy weighting towards Notice of Sale filings in Chippewa County suggests that a substantial portion of distressed properties are on a fast track toward a completed foreclosure, a key signal for investors looking for pre-foreclosure data.

All 33 active pre-foreclosures in Chippewa County are categorized as Residential properties, accounting for 100.0% of the pipeline. Further breakdown by property type detail reveals that Single Family homes dominate, with 32 properties making up 97.0% of the total. A single Condominium Unit accounts for the remaining 1 property, or 3.0%. Local Market Context

Chippewa County's pre-foreclosure landscape, while numerically small at 33 active filings, provides important insights when viewed against broader state and national trends. The state of Michigan registered a total of 12,868 active pre-foreclosures during the same period, while the national total stood at 283,909. Chippewa County's 0.3% share of the state total highlights its relatively smaller contribution to Michigan's overall distressed housing inventory, consistent with its rank of #44 among 82 counties. This indicates that while pre-foreclosure activity is present, it is not as widespread or concentrated as in other, potentially larger or more economically stressed, counties within the state.

The most striking feature of Chippewa County's pre-foreclosure data is the overwhelming dominance of properties in the Notice of Sale stage. With 87.9% of all active pre-foreclosures at this late juncture, the county exhibits a significantly "older" pipeline compared to what might be seen in markets with a more balanced distribution across stages. This means that for properties entering the pre-foreclosure process in Chippewa, a high percentage are progressing quickly towards auction.
